作为全球领先的云计算服务商,阿里云构建了覆盖计算、存储、网络、安全等领域的完整服务矩阵。其核心服务体系可归纳为以下六大支柱:

- 计算服务:弹性计算EC2、容器服务ACK、函数计算FC
- 数据库服务:关系型数据库RDS、NoSQL数据库MongoDB/Redis、数据仓库AnalyticDB
- 存储服务:对象存储OSS、块存储EBS、文件存储NAS
- 网络服务:虚拟私有云VPC、负载均衡SLB、全球加速GA
- 安全服务:Web应用防火墙WAF、DDoS防护、数据加密服务
- 大数据与AI:实时计算Flink、机器学习PAI、智能语音交互
弹性计算ECS:云端基石
弹性计算服务(Elastic Compute Service)是阿里云最核心的基础产品,提供可扩展的虚拟化服务器。其特色在于:
“按需取用、弹性伸缩的设计理念,让企业无需预先投入硬件成本即可获得稳定的计算能力”
| 实例类型 | 适用场景 | 核心优势 |
|---|---|---|
| 通用型g7 | Web应用、中小数据库 | 均衡的计算与内存配比 |
| 计算型c7 | 高性能计算、游戏服务器 | 超高计算性能 |
| 内存型r7 | 内存数据库、大数据分析 | 超大内存容量 |
数据库服务矩阵深度解析
阿里云数据库服务提供完整的数据管理解决方案:
- 云原生数据库PolarDB:100%兼容MySQL/PostgreSQL,存储容量最高达100TB
- 云数据库RDS:提供MySQL、SQL Server、PostgreSQL引擎,支持自动备份与监控
- NoSQL数据库:文档数据库MongoDB支持分片集群,Redis提供微秒级延迟
- 数据仓库AnalyticDB:实时OLAP分析,PB级数据查询响应时间仅需秒级
架构抉择:云服务器 vs 数据库服务
选择自建数据库还是使用托管数据库服务,需基于以下维度综合考量:
| 对比维度 | 自建数据库(ECS) | 托管数据库(RDS) |
|---|---|---|
| 管理复杂度 | 需自行安装、配置、优化 | 全托管,开箱即用 |
| 可用性保证 | 依赖自行搭建高可用架构 | 默认提供主备架构,99.95% SLA |
| 扩展能力 | 需手动分库分表 | 弹性扩展,按需升降配 |
| 成本结构 | 固定成本+运维人力成本 | 按使用量计费,无运维成本 |
典型场景选择指南
选择云服务器自建数据库的情况:
- 需要完全控制数据库内核参数的特殊业务场景
- 已有成熟的DBA团队,具备完善的数据库运维能力
- 使用特定版本的数据库或自定义分支版本
选择托管数据库服务的情况:
- 初创企业或中小团队,缺乏专业DBA资源
- 业务快速变化,需要灵活弹性伸缩的场景
- 对数据可靠性要求极高,需要专业级别的备份恢复保障
- 希望聚焦业务开发而非基础设施运维
架构演进最佳实践
实际应用中,混合架构往往是最优解。建议采用分层架构:
“核心交易数据使用RDS保证可靠性,海量日志数据存储于ECS自建数据库控制成本,缓存层使用云Redis提升性能”
随着业务规模扩大,可从ECS自建逐步迁移至云原生数据库PolarDB,实现平滑过渡的同时享受云原生技术红利。
内容均以整理官方公开资料,价格可能随活动调整,请以购买页面显示为准,如涉侵权,请联系客服处理。
本文由星速云发布。发布者:星速云。禁止采集与转载行为,违者必究。出处:https://www.67wa.com/83666.html